Codonopilate A (1), a triterpenyl ester, was isolated from monocultivated soil of annual Codonopsis pilosula and identified as the main autotoxin. The yield ratio codonopilate in dried calculated 2.04 μg/g. Other two triterpenoids, taraxeryl acetate (2) 24-methylenecycloartanol (3), were well showing weaker autotoxity. This first time that potential allelochemicals autotoxins cultivated reported. Accumulation reactive oxygen species (ROS) induced by root tips considered an important factor...

Allelochemicals are the media of allelopathy and form chemical bases plant-environment interactions. To determine true allelochemicals their autotoxic effects, seven compounds were isolated identified from in-situ sampled rhizosphere soil cultivated Saussurea lappa. Of these; costunolide (2), dehydrocostus lactone (3) scopoletin (4) showed significant inhibition on seedling growth in a concentration-dependent manner. Detection observation demonstrated that antioxidase system was found to be...

Abstract Variations in snow cover (as specific precipitation) can have an important effect on development of biological soil crusts (BSCs) arid and semiarid regions, where water is the principal limiting factor for microorganisms. However, there still limited knowledge available regarding effects snowfall properties microbial biomass BSCs. To examine these cover, three types BSCs (cyanobacteria‐dominated, lichen‐dominated, moss‐dominated crusts) were collected exposed to five depths 3 years....

Water is a major limiting factor for plant growth in arid and semi-arid regions. To find out the main sources of water two artificial sand-fixation plants (Caragana korshinskii Artemisia ordosica), we analyzed characteristics hydrogen oxygen stable isotopes molecules rainfall, soil xylem water. analyze these plants, used direct comparison method multi-variate mixed linear model. The results showed that an equation local meteoric line Shapotou was δD=7.83δ18O+5.64 (R2=0.91). value rainfall...
